Question 2

The Myers-Briggs Type Indicator classifies people in all of the following categories except ________.
 
  A) extraverted/introverted
  B) sensing/intuitive
  C) perceiving/judging
  D) independent/dependent
  E) thinking/feeling

Answer to Question 2

D
Explanation: D) In the Myers-Briggs Type Indicator, individuals are classified as extraverted or introverted (E or I), sensing or intuitive (S or N), thinking or feeling (T or F), and judging or perceiving ( J or P). Therefore, independent/dependent is not an MBTI classification.

The lipid bilayer is made of phospholipids. They are arranged in a double layer because one of their ends is attracted to water while the other is repelled by water.
